Everytime I create a new table in this one particular document all the
lines in the table show up with arrowheads. How do I get rid of them?
(other than copying everything to a new document, or importing all new
tables from a new document, which would be very time consuming)

Using Powerpoint 2004. Operating system is 10.4.8. I copied the file
over to our PC and the file had the same issues when I tried to create
a new table.
